The Van't Hoff factor will be highest for

  • Option 1)

    Sodium chloride

  • Option 2)

    Magnesium chloride

  • Option 3)

    Sodium phosphate

  • Option 4)

    Urea

 

Answers (2)

As we learned

 

Vant Hoff factor for dissociation -

i= 1+(n-1)\alpha

Where

n is the no. of dissociated particles

\alpha = degree of dissociation
 

- wherein

NaC l \: \: \: n = 2

CaCl_{2} \: \: \: n = 3

K_{4}[F(CN_{6})]\: \: \: \: \: n=5

 

 Na3PO4 gives maximum four ion it is show highest Vant’s haff factor.
